Sustainment Mechanical Engineer
Red Cat Holdings is seeking a Sustainment Mechanical Engineer responsible for the ongoing support, improvement, and reliability of released mechanical and electromechanical products. The role involves owning mechanical design changes, resolving quality and manufacturing issues, and ensuring product performance and compliance throughout the production lifecycle.

Responsibilities
Own mechanical sustainment activities for released products across production and fielded units
Investigate and resolve quality, reliability, and manufacturing issues through structured root-cause analysis
Develop and implement engineering change orders (ECOs) and product updates while maintaining configuration control
Perform structural FEA to assess design changes, fatigue, durability, and failure modes
Conduct vibration and modal analysis to evaluate field failures, resonance issues, and environmental loading
Perform thermal and heat transfer analysis to support corrective actions and design improvements
Design and update injection-molded plastic and machined components, ensuring tooling and production readiness
Support production, suppliers, and contract manufacturers with design clarifications and corrective actions
Collaborate with Quality, Manufacturing, Supply Chain, and Verification Test teams to drive issue resolution
Support failure analysis activities, including test correlation and data review
Ensure DFM/DFA and DFT best practices are applied to sustainment design changes
Maintain accurate CAD models, drawings, specifications, and GD&T
Own mechanical document control, including drawings, BOMs, change history, and release status in the PLM system
Support production line issues, yield improvement, and cost-reduction initiatives
Assist in supplier change evaluations and part obsolescence mitigation
Provide technical guidance to manufacturing and quality teams during audits and reviews
